正如您所看到的,这些东西非常讨厌,它没有提供任何有用的信息。但是,有一件事我没有注意。这是编译期间的一个奇怪的警告,也很难用眼睛捕捉到:
In file included from d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er.h:50:0,
from d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/QSharedPointer:1,
from ../../../../source/libraries/Project/sources/Method.hpp:4,
from ../../../../source/libraries/Project/sources/Slot.hpp:4,
from ../../../../source/libraries/Project/sources/Slot.cpp:1:
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h: In instantiation of 'static void QtSharedPointer::ExternalRefCount<T>::deref(QtSharedPointer::ExternalRefCount<T>::Data*, T*) [with T = Project::Method::Private; QtSharedPointer::ExternalRefCount<T>::Data = QtSharedPointer::ExternalRefCountData]':
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h:336:11: required from 'void QtSharedPointer::ExternalRefCount<T>::deref() [with T = Project::Method::Private]'
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h:401:38: required from 'QtSharedPointer::ExternalRefCount<T>::~ExternalRefCount() [with T = Project::Method::Private]'
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h:466:7: required from here
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h:342:21: warning: possible problem detected in invocation of delete operator: [enabled by default]
d:/Libraries/x64/MinGW-w64/4.7.2/Qt/4.8.4/include/QtCore/qsharedpointer_impl.h:337:28: warning: 'value' has incomplete type [enabled by default]
实际上,我只是将这个警告作为最后的手段,因为在如此绝望地寻找错误的过程中,代码已经感染了字面上的日志死亡。
仔细阅读后,我想起了,例如,如果使用std::unique_ptr
或std::scoped_ptr
用于Pimpl - 肯定应该提供析构函数,否则代码甚至无法编译。但是,我还记得它std::shared_ptr
不关心析构函数并且没有它也可以正常工作。这也是我没有注意这个奇怪警告的另一个原因。长话短说,当我添加析构函数时,这种随机崩溃停止了。看起来 QtQSharedPointer
与std::shared_ptr
. 我想如果 Qt 开发人员将此警告转化为错误会更好,因为这样的调试马拉松根本不值得花时间、精力和精力。
